Why Is Google Search So Competitive for Carpet Cleaners in Glendale?

Glendale sits in one of the fastest-growing metros in the country. The city’s population has pushed past 250,000, and with new housing developments constantly going up near the Loop 101 and along Bell Road, there’s no shortage of homeowners who need carpet cleaning services. That demand attracts competition — both from local owner-operators and from national franchise chains that have dedicated SEO teams and significant budgets.

The local map pack (the three business listings that appear at the top of Google search results) captures the majority of clicks for service-area searches like “carpet cleaning Glendale AZ.” Getting into that pack — and staying there — requires consistent work across your Google Business Profile, your website, and your citation footprint. Most small carpet cleaning companies skip at least one of those three, which is exactly why they’re stuck on page two or three.

What Does SEO Actually Look Like for a Glendale Carpet Cleaning Business?

Good SEO for a carpet cleaning company isn’t about stuffing keywords onto a generic website. It’s about building a technically sound site that clearly communicates what you do, where you do it, and why customers should trust you — and then making sure Google can find, crawl, and rank every page correctly.

Google Business Profile Optimization

Your Google Business Profile is the single most important local ranking factor for service businesses. For Glendale carpet cleaners, that means setting your service area correctly to cover neighborhoods like Arrowhead Ranch, Westgate, and portions of neighboring Peoria and Sun City. It means selecting the right primary and secondary categories, publishing regular posts, responding to every review, and keeping your hours, phone number, and website URL accurate at all times. Small inconsistencies here quietly hurt your rankings without any obvious warning sign.

On-Page SEO and Service Pages

Every service you offer — steam cleaning, pet odor removal, upholstery cleaning, tile and grout — deserves its own page with specific, locally relevant content. A single “Services” page that lists everything in a few bullet points won’t rank for anything meaningful. Each page needs to address what the customer is searching for, answer common questions, and include location signals that tell Google you actually serve Glendale and the surrounding West Valley communities.

Technical Foundations

Page speed, mobile usability, and structured data matter more than most carpet cleaning business owners realize. A large percentage of local searches happen on smartphones while someone is standing in a room looking at a stain. If your site loads slowly on mobile or buries your phone number, you lose that customer before they ever call. Structured data — specifically LocalBusiness schema — helps Google surface your business information more prominently in search results.

The Seasonal Angle: Glendale’s Market Timing Matters

Arizona’s climate creates predictable demand windows that smart carpet cleaners can capitalize on through SEO content. The period right after monsoon season — typically August through October — drives a surge in searches as homeowners deal with tracked-in dirt and moisture-related odors. Similarly, the stretch between Thanksgiving and Christmas sees a spike as families prepare for holiday guests. Publishing content that addresses these seasonal concerns a few weeks before demand peaks positions your site to capture that traffic when it arrives.

Spring cleaning is another strong window in the West Valley. As snowbirds return to Sun City and Surprise, and Glendale residents open up homes that have been sealed against the summer heat, carpet cleaning searches climb noticeably. An SEO strategy that ignores these seasonal patterns leaves real revenue on the table.

Local Link Building: How Glendale Businesses Build Authority

Links from other reputable websites tell Google that your business is trusted and established. For a Glendale carpet cleaner, the most natural and effective sources include local business directories, the Glendale Chamber of Commerce, neighborhood community platforms, and local home services blogs. Sponsoring a community event near State Farm Stadium or partnering with a real estate agent in the Arrowhead area can generate the kind of locally relevant mentions that both build authority and drive direct referrals.

National directory listings — Yelp, Angi, HomeAdvisor — also contribute to your citation profile, which is a separate but related signal. The key is consistency: your business name, address, and phone number need to match exactly across every platform. Even minor variations (like “Ave” versus “Avenue”) can dilute the signal Google uses to verify your business is legitimate.

How Does SEO Compare to Google Ads for Carpet Cleaners?

Google Ads can get your phone ringing this week. SEO builds a pipeline that keeps ringing for years. Most successful carpet cleaning businesses in competitive markets like Glendale use both, but in different ways and at different stages of growth. Ads are excellent for filling gaps in your calendar quickly or launching a new service area. SEO is what makes you the dominant, trusted brand in Glendale search results over time — without paying for every single click.

The businesses that outcompete everyone else in the West Valley are the ones that treat SEO as an ongoing investment, not a one-time project. They update their content, earn new reviews, build new links, and refine their service pages regularly. That consistency is what the algorithm rewards. Frequently Asked Questions: SEO for Carpet Cleaners in Glendale, AZ

How long does it take for SEO to produce results for a Glendale carpet cleaning company?

Most carpet cleaning businesses in Glendale see measurable movement in local rankings within three to six months of consistent SEO work. The map pack tends to respond faster than organic blue-link rankings. The timeline depends on how competitive your specific target keywords are and the current state of your website and Google Business Profile.

Do I need a physical address in Glendale to rank there?

Not necessarily. Google allows service-area businesses — those that travel to the customer rather than serving them at a fixed location — to rank in the map pack without displaying a physical address. You do need a verified Google Business Profile with your service area set correctly to include Glendale and the surrounding communities you want to target.

What keywords should a Glendale carpet cleaning company target?

Start with high-intent, location-specific terms like “carpet cleaning Glendale AZ,” “steam cleaning near me,” and “pet odor removal Glendale.” Layer in neighborhood-level terms for areas like Arrowhead Ranch and Westgate, and add service-specific pages for upholstery cleaning, tile cleaning, and area rug cleaning to capture searches across your full offering.

How important are Google reviews for SEO rankings?

Reviews are a significant local ranking factor. The quantity, recency, and sentiment of your Google reviews all influence where your business appears in the map pack. Actively requesting reviews from satisfied customers — especially mentioning Glendale and the specific service performed — gives your profile a consistent signal that Google rewards.

Can I do SEO myself, or do I need an agency?

Some basics — like keeping your Google Business Profile updated and responding to reviews — are manageable on your own. Technical SEO, competitive keyword research, link building, and ongoing content strategy require considerably more time and expertise. Most carpet cleaning owners find that their time is better spent running their business while a specialist handles the SEO work.
